Advertisement

KMeans算法的机器学习评估

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文探讨了KMeans算法在机器学习中的应用,并详细介绍了如何对其性能进行有效的评估。通过多种数据集测试,揭示了该算法的优势与局限性。 这段代码包含了评估机器学习KMeans算法中不同K值的准则值的方法,能够直观地展示不同K值对应的准则值差异。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• KMeans
    优质
    本文探讨了KMeans算法在机器学习中的应用,并详细介绍了如何对其性能进行有效的评估。通过多种数据集测试,揭示了该算法的优势与局限性。 这段代码包含了评估机器学习KMeans算法中不同K值的准则值的方法,能够直观地展示不同K值对应的准则值差异。
  • Kmeans实验报告
    优质
    本实验报告详细探讨了基于K-means算法的数据聚类过程,通过Python编程实践,分析了算法在不同数据集上的表现与优化策略。 机器学习关于Kmeans的实验报告,内含代码,实验内容是对鹦鹉图片的颜色进行聚类分析。
  • 模型PPT
    优质
    本PPT深入探讨了机器学习领域中模型评估的关键方法与技巧,涵盖准确性、召回率、F1分数等核心指标,并提供实用案例分析。 模型评估是通过实验方法来测量学习器的性能,并以此作为评判标准。此外还可以利用假设检验比较不同学习器之间的泛化能力。我们可以通过实验测试对学习器的泛化误差进行评估并做出选择。为此,需要使用一个“测试集”来测试学习器,然后以该测试集中得到的“测试误差”作为泛化误差的一种近似值。
  • 银行客户风险应用.zip
    优质
    本研究探讨了在银行业务中运用机器学习技术进行客户风险评估的应用。通过分析大量历史数据,开发出高效的风险预测模型,旨在提升金融机构的风险管理能力与客户服务体验。 在金融行业中特别是银行业务领域里,对客户风险的评估至关重要,这直接影响贷款审批、信用评分以及风险管理等一系列业务决策。本资料包“机器学习-使用机器学习算法进行银行客户风险评估”旨在探讨如何利用先进的机器学习技术来提高风险评估的准确性和效率。 一、机器学习简介 作为人工智能的一个分支,机器学习使计算机系统能够通过分析数据自动改进预测模型而无需显式编程。在银行业务中,这种技术可以用于挖掘大量历史交易记录和信用信息,识别潜在的风险模式。 二、客户风险评估的重要性 银行提供信贷服务时必须准确地评估客户的还款能力和意愿以减少违约的可能性。传统的风险评估方法依赖于规则与人工判断,效率低下且容易受到主观因素的影响。相比之下,机器学习算法能够自动化这一过程,并提高决策的准确性及速度。 三、常用机器学习算法 1. 逻辑回归:适用于分类问题,例如预测客户是否会逾期还款。 2. 决策树和随机森林:通过构建多棵树来评估风险等级,易于理解和解释复杂关系。 3. 随机梯度下降法(SGD):适合处理大规模数据集,在线学习算法可以实时更新模型以适应新信息。 4. 支持向量机(SVM):在高维空间中寻找最佳分类边界,对小样本数据表现良好。 5. 朴素贝叶斯:假设特征间相互独立,适用于文本数据分析如客户的申请信件内容分析。 6. 深度学习:通过神经网络模型自动提取复杂特征,在处理大量多维度数据时表现出色。 四、数据预处理 在应用机器学习算法之前进行充分的数据清洗(包括缺失值和异常值的处理)、编码类别变量为数值形式以及构建新的预测变量等操作是十分必要的。此外,还需要对原始数据执行标准化或归一化步骤以提高模型训练效果。 五、模型训练与验证 采用交叉验证方法如K折交叉验证来确保所建立模型具有良好的泛化能力,并防止过拟合和欠拟合现象的发生。通过比较不同算法的表现选择最优方案。评估标准通常包括准确率、召回率、F1分数以及AUC-ROC曲线等指标。 六、模型优化与调参 使用网格搜索或随机搜索技术调整参数以提升性能,同时应用正则化策略避免过度拟合问题的发生。 七、模型部署与监控 将训练好的模型应用于实际业务场景,并持续监测其表现情况。定期更新和维护该系统以便应对不断变化的市场环境。 综上所述,在银行客户风险评估中运用机器学习技术具有重要意义,通过选择恰当算法、处理数据集、训练优化模型可以显著提高风险管理的质量,从而帮助金融机构做出更加明智的信贷决策。
  • -KMeans-上海大
    优质
    本课程由上海大学精心设计,专注于讲解机器学习中的KMeans聚类算法。通过理论与实践结合的方式,帮助学员深入理解并掌握该算法的应用技巧和优化方法。 上海大学-机器学习-计算机专业课 实验内容: 通过对给定数据进行聚类分析来了解K-means算法。 实验目标: 通过本实验掌握K-means聚类算法。 实验准备: 点击屏幕右上方的下载实验数据模块,选择下载KmeansData.txt到指定目录下。然后再依次选择点击上方的File->Open->Upload,上传刚才下载的数据集。 数据介绍: 该数据是随机生成的符合高斯分布的二维样本点。
  • 基于Python树叶枯萎程度.zip
    优质
    本项目探索了利用Python编程语言和机器学习技术来量化并预测树叶因各种因素导致的枯萎程度。通过分析图像数据和其他相关环境参数,模型能够有效评估树木健康状况,并为林业管理和生态保护提供科学依据。此研究还提供了代码实现及实验结果展示,有助于进一步的研究与应用开发。 资源包含文件:课程设计报告(word格式)及代码(使用Python中的scikit-learn机器学习框架对模型进行训练)。数据集按照0.85:0.15的比例被分割成训练集和测试集,在相同的预处理步骤下,分别采用了六种不同的模型进行了训练。最终得到了各模型的拟合优度,并在报告中详细介绍了相关过程与结果。
  • 基于电池SOC
    优质
    本研究提出了一种基于机器学习技术的新型电池荷电状态(SOC)估计方法。该算法通过分析大量电池运行数据,优化模型参数,提高估算精度和鲁棒性,为电动汽车及储能系统提供更可靠的电力管理方案。 电池SOC估计的机器学习算法研究涉及利用数据驱动的方法来提高对电池荷电状态(State of Charge, SOC)的预测准确性。这种技术对于优化电动汽车和其他依赖电池系统的设备性能至关重要,能够帮助延长电池寿命并提升能源效率。通过训练模型以识别和理解复杂的充电与放电模式,研究人员可以开发出更加精确且可靠的SOC估算方法。
  • KMeans应用案例
    优质
    本文档探讨了K-Means算法在机器学习领域的实际应用场景与案例分析,深入解析其工作原理及优化策略。 在机器学习领域,K-means算法是一个应用非常广泛的聚类方法。本段落档将介绍一些该算法的实际应用场景。